Herman Miller's leap of faith

Article Abstract:

The Aeron chair, Herman Miller's most popular product, named one of the 'Designs of the Decade' for the 1990s, which was a must in Internet companies, with a profit of $2.2 billion, was in liquidation sales and had downsized the workforce and closed plants. During the period when business was down by 45 percent, Herman Miller decided to take a risk of investing in R&D, which bears the fruits of its decision, is introducing more products than at any time in its history.

The Gucci killers

Article Abstract:

China is on the verge of fielding high end fashion that can compete with any major city in the world like Paris, New York or Milan. Raphael le Masne de Chermont who is the CEO and Joanne Ooi who is a creative director have made Shanghai Tang into a flagship store in Hong Kong's Central District, that reveals a delicate balancing act where a look is created that is both authentic and sophisticated.

The beauty of simplicity

Article Abstract:

Some of the technology products that offer great performance along with simplicity of design are discussed. The benefits associated with these products such as TiVo, by TiVo, IPod, by Apple and Google's search engine, are discussed.
